Vanadium in Ascidians

1990
About 80 years ago Henze (1911) found unexpectedly that ascidian blood cells contained a high level of vanadium. The initial interest in this phenomenon was not only the presence of vanadium but also the possibility that other metals might be concentrated in ascidians and other organisms.

Metamorphosis in Ascidians

BioScience, 1983
Tadpole larvae are found in three orders and 10 families of ascidians (phylum Chordata, subphylum Urochordata or Tunicata) and range in length from about 0.6 mm to 11.0 mm.
